Web4 jan. 2024 · Some 19% of adults report owning an e-reader – a handheld device such as a Kindle or Nook primarily used for reading e-books. This is a sizable drop from early 2014 when 32% of adults owned this type of device. Ownership of e-readers is somewhat more common among women (22%) than men (15%). Web2 okt. 2024 · This month, NPD Books published a reading survey that stated “nearly three out of four consumers in the U.S. reported reading a book or listening to an audiobook in the past six months.”. That’s almost exactly the same as Pew’s figure of 72% of respondents who have read a book in the past 12 months in any format.

Web6 dec. 2024 · In October of 2024, over 80% of adults, age 18 to 29, have read at least one book in the previous year. Older adults, possibly because they are not spending as much time studying and more time working, read slightly less.
